Understanding the Basement Environment
Basements present a set of unique challenges that need to be taken into account when choosing wall - covering materials. The most prominent issues in basements include high humidity, potential for water seepage, and limited ventilation. High humidity levels are common because basements are below ground level, making them more prone to water vapor accumulation. Water seepage can occur through cracks in the foundation or due to poor waterproofing, leading to wet walls. Additionally, basements usually have less air circulation compared to upper floors, which can exacerbate the problems caused by moisture.
Properties of WPC Wall Panels
WPC wall panels are made by combining wood fibers and plastic polymers. This combination gives them several properties that make them potentially suitable for basement applications:
1. Moisture Resistance
One of the key advantages of WPC wall panels is their excellent moisture resistance. The plastic component in the composite acts as a barrier against water, preventing the wood fibers from absorbing excessive moisture. Unlike traditional wood panels, WPC panels will not rot, warp, or develop mold when exposed to high humidity or small amounts of water. This makes them a great option for basements, where moisture is a constant concern. For example, in regions with high groundwater levels, WPC wall panels can withstand the damp conditions without degrading.
2. Durability
WPC wall panels are highly durable. They are resistant to wear and tear, scratches, and impact. In a basement, where there might be less foot traffic but still the possibility of accidental bumps or knocks (for example, when moving storage items), WPC panels can maintain their integrity. Their long - lasting nature means that once installed in a basement, they will not need frequent replacement, saving you both time and money in the long run.
3. Easy Installation and Maintenance
Installing WPC wall panels is a relatively straightforward process. They often come with a tongue - and - groove system, which allows for quick and seamless installation. This is especially beneficial in basements, as it can reduce the time and disruption associated with a renovation project. In terms of maintenance, WPC panels are easy to clean. A simple wipe with a damp cloth is usually sufficient to remove dirt and stains. This ease of maintenance is ideal for basements, which are often used for storage and may not receive as much attention as other areas of the house.

Challenges and Considerations
While WPC wall panels have many advantages, there are also some challenges and considerations when using them in basements:
1. Extreme Water Exposure
Although WPC wall panels are moisture - resistant, they are not completely waterproof. In cases of severe water seepage or flooding, the panels may be damaged if they are submerged for an extended period. Therefore, it is crucial to ensure that your basement has proper waterproofing measures in place. This may include waterproofing the foundation, installing a sump pump, and improving drainage around the house.
2. Temperature Variations
Basements can experience significant temperature variations, especially in regions with cold winters or hot summers. WPC wall panels can expand and contract with temperature changes, which may lead to gaps or warping over time. To mitigate this issue, it's important to leave some expansion space during installation. Professional installers are well - aware of these requirements and can ensure that the panels are installed correctly to accommodate temperature fluctuations.
3. Ventilation
Limited ventilation in basements can cause moisture to build up, even with moisture - resistant materials like WPC wall panels. Adequate ventilation is essential to maintain a healthy environment and prevent the growth of mold and mildew. You can install a ventilation system, such as exhaust fans or air circulators, to improve air flow in your basement.
Specific Applications and Examples
There are several ways to use WPC wall panels in basements:
1. Finishing the Walls
WPC wall panels can be used to finish the bare concrete or brick walls of a basement. This not only improves the appearance of the space but also provides an extra layer of insulation and protection against moisture.
